Water‐soluble amine‐functionalized polyhedral oligomeric silsesquioxane promotes concurrent latex coalescence and crosslinking, allowing epoxy‐functional particles to form continuous films without added volatile coalescing agents. The resulting multiscale‐reinforced waterborne coatings combine high strength, toughness, optical transparency, scratch ...

A CD14‐Targeting In Situ Hydrogel Directs Macrophage Reprogramming to Minimize Scar Formation
A CD14‐targeting in situ hydrogel formed from a microbial polysaccharide rapidly remodels the immune microenvironment by reprogramming macrophage polarization, suppressing excessive inflammation, and coordinating tissue regeneration.
